Where are the Fighting Dems?

From tristero at Hullabaloo:

Surely the Democrats have some major announcement today to remove the spotlight that’s been shining on the viscous mass of white ooze that infested St. Paul. The couldn’t be so stupid as not to have planned a major rebuttal to the lies, distortion, and stupidity on display this past week. 

We’re gonna hear about something big from Barack today. Right? RIGHT????

